That’s exactly how many we’ve got tonight. A few. We begin the evening with a shot of a bald, robotically enhanced Matt Damon in a new shot from Neill Blomkamp’s Elysium. For a movie being made with such a low profile, that sure is a big image. A Chem-rail gun (I don’t know what that is, but it sounds fun) and some exoskeletal goodness. Plus, Damon is looking quite militant. Here’s hoping we get more of this one at Comic-Con next week.
